如何精确查询数据库文件是否存在?有哪些查找方法?

要查找数据库文件是否存在,你可以使用以下几种方法:

怎么查找数据库文件是否存在

使用操作系统命令

以下是一些常见操作系统中查找数据库文件的方法:

操作系统 命令
Windows dirfindstr
macOS/Linux lsfind

Windows示例

  1. 打开命令提示符(cmd)。
  2. 使用dir命令查找文件:
    dir C:pathtodatabase.db
  3. 如果文件存在,它将在命令提示符中列出。

macOS/Linux示例

  1. 打开终端。
  2. 使用ls命令查找文件:
    ls /path/to/database.db
  3. 如果文件存在,它将在终端中列出。

使用数据库管理工具

大多数数据库管理工具都提供了查找数据库文件的功能。

数据库 工具
MySQL MySQL Workbench
PostgreSQL pgAdmin
MongoDB MongoDB Compass

MySQL示例

  1. 打开MySQL Workbench。
  2. 连接到MySQL服务器。
  3. 在左侧导航栏中,选择“数据目录”。
  4. 如果文件存在,它将在数据目录中列出。

编写脚本

如果你熟悉编程,可以编写一个脚本来检查文件是否存在。

Python示例

import os
file_path = "/path/to/database.db"
if os.path.exists(file_path):
    print("文件存在")
else:
    print("文件不存在")

FAQs

Q1:如何使用Windows的findstr命令查找文件?

怎么查找数据库文件是否存在

A1:你可以使用以下命令:

findstr /I "database.db" C:pathtosearch

这里的/I参数用于忽略大小写,"database.db"是你要查找的文件名,C:pathtosearch是搜索路径。

Q2:如何在Linux中使用find命令查找文件?

A2:你可以使用以下命令:

怎么查找数据库文件是否存在

find /path/to/search name "database.db"

这里的/path/to/search是搜索路径,name "database.db"用于指定要查找的文件名。

原创文章,发布者:酷盾叔,转转请注明出处:https://www.kd.cn/ask/174923.html

(0)
酷盾叔的头像酷盾叔
上一篇 2025年10月11日 01:54
下一篇 2025年10月11日 02:00

相关推荐

  • 如何高效地将Excel表格数据更新至数据库,操作步骤详解?

    Excel表如何更新数据库,是一个常见的问题,尤其是在数据分析和报表生成过程中,以下是一个详细的步骤指南,帮助您了解如何将Excel表中的数据更新到数据库中,Excel表更新数据库步骤步骤说明准备Excel文件确保您的Excel文件包含需要更新的数据,如果数据分布在多个工作表中,请确保它们都在同一个工作簿中,准……

    2025年9月27日
    100
  • php怎么跨页面传递数据库

    可通过 $_SESSION 存储查询结果,跳转时自动携带;或拼接到 URL 参数/表单隐藏域,新页接收

    2025年8月11日
    300
  • Java中如何高效调用数据库实现数据交互?

    在Java中调用数据库通常涉及以下几个步骤:加载数据库驱动,建立数据库连接,创建SQL语句,执行SQL语句,处理结果集,关闭数据库连接,以下是一个详细的步骤和示例:加载数据库驱动你需要将数据库的JDBC驱动添加到项目中,这可以通过将JDBC驱动的jar文件添加到项目的类路径中来实现,// 加载数据库驱动Clas……

    2025年10月15日
    100
  • 数据库表怎么创建

    用 CREATE TABLE 语句创建,指定表名,括号内定义各字段(含名称、数据类型、约束),以分号

    2025年8月6日
    300
  • 数据库检查提交操作,是否存在简便高效的方法?

    在数据库管理中,检查数据库是否有提交是一个非常重要的任务,这有助于确保数据的完整性和一致性,以下是一些常见的方法和步骤,可以帮助你检查数据库是否有提交:使用数据库管理工具大多数数据库管理工具都提供了检查提交状态的选项,以下是一些常用的工具:工具名称检查提交的方法MySQL Workbench在查询窗口中执行 S……

    2025年9月19日
    000

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

400-880-8834

在线咨询: QQ交谈

邮件:HI@E.KD.CN